Know Before You Go:
- Be Prepared: "While some rides offer SAG (Support and Gear) vehicles, it's always wise to come prepared. At a minimum, carry a spare tube and basic tools. Knowing how to fix a flat can save you from being stranded."
- Safety First: "Group rides prioritize safety. Listen carefully to ride leaders and follow their instructions. Be aware of your surroundings, use hand signals, and ride predictably. Helmets are strongly encouraged, and some rides may require them."
- Ride Etiquette: "Be courteous to your fellow riders and other road users. Maintain a safe distance, avoid sudden stops, and communicate clearly."
- Check for Updates: "Ride details (locations, times, routes) can sometimes change. Always check the hosting group's website or social media page for the most up-to-date information before heading out."
- Bring Essentials: "Consider bringing water, snacks, and appropriate clothing for the weather conditions."

Ride: Slow Roll Detroit
Experience the legendary Slow Roll Detroit! Hosted by the city ambassador Jason Hall, this isn't just a bike ride; it's a Detroit institution and the city's largest weekly cycling event. Welcoming riders of all ages and abilities, Slow Roll offers a unique opportunity to leisurely explore the diverse streets and vibrant neighborhoods of Downtown Detroit and its surroundings. Expect a family-friendly and inclusive atmosphere, where the emphasis is on community and enjoying the ride together at a comfortable pace. Helmets are required, and bringing a spare tube is highly recommended to ensure a smooth journey for everyone. Join the rolling celebration! Meet up at the Trek Store on Woodward Ave at 6 pm for a 6:15 pm departure. Connect with the Slow Roll community on their Facebook page: https://www.facebook.com/groups/1211154165991994. Limited SAG support is available.
